JUNE 18, 2026
Acting Attorney General Todd Blanche Appoints National Coordinator for Child Exploitation and Human Trafficking
Acting Attorney General Todd Blanche announced the establishment of a National Coordinator to lead the fight against child exploitation and human trafficking across the United States. The National Coordinator will spearhead the U.S. Department of Justice's strategies for combatting human trafficking, while serving as the Department's liaison to federal agencies and external stakeholders for implementing anti-human trafficking initiatives.
Acting Attorney General Blanche has appointed Alessandra Serano to serve as the National Coordinator. With an extensive history at the Department of Justice, Ms. Serano most recently served as Senior Counsel to the Deputy Attorney General.
